ORDER
The present Writ Petition has been filed for the issuance of a Writ of Mandamus, to direct the second respondent to take appropriate action against the private respondents 3 and 4 based on the petitioner's complaint dated 14.01.2026 and conclude the enquiry. 2.When the matter is taken up for hearing today, the learned Government Advocate (Crl. Side) appearing for the respondent Police submitted that based on the complaint given by the petitioner, a case in Crime No.56 of 2026 has been registered.
3.Recording the submission made by the learned Government Advocate (Crl. Side), this writ petition stands closed. There shall be no order as to costs.
